WASHINGTON, Dec 10 (Reuters) - US Secretary of State Hillary Clinton will tell
Israel and the Palestinians on Friday that Washington is committed to peace but it is their responsibility to end their conflict, the State Department said on Friday.
She will make clear that the United States remains committed to this process but that responsibility to end the conflict ultimately rests with the parties themselves, State Department spokesman P.J. Crowley told reporters, referring to a speech Clinton is due to give at 8 p.m. EST on Friday (0100 GMT on Saturday).
